About Harm Bartholomeus
Harm Bartholomeus is a scholar working on Environmental Engineering, Ecology, Global and Planetary Change, Nature and Landscape Conservation and Soil Science, having authored 122 papers that have together received 6.0k indexed citations. Recurring topics across this work include Remote Sensing and LiDAR Applications (52 papers), Remote Sensing in Agriculture (44 papers), Soil Geostatistics and Mapping (23 papers), Forest ecology and management (19 papers), Land Use and Ecosystem Services (15 papers), Plant Water Relations and Carbon Dynamics (15 papers), Forest Ecology and Biodiversity Studies (12 papers) and Geochemistry and Geologic Mapping (11 papers). The work is most often cited by research in Environmental Engineering (3.8k citations), Nature and Landscape Conservation (1.5k citations), Geology (536 citations), Ecology (2.3k citations) and Insect Science (741 citations). Harm Bartholomeus has collaborated with scholars based in Netherlands, United Kingdom and Belgium. Frequent co-authors include Lammert Kooistra, Kim Calders, Martin Herold, Alvaro Lau, Benjamin Brede, A.K. Bregt, Juha Suomalainen, Alim Pulatov, Mathias Disney and Sébastien Bauwens. Their work appears in journals such as International Journal of Applied Earth Observation and Geoinformation, Remote Sensing, Remote Sensing of Environment, Sensors and Methods in Ecology and Evolution.
